What Are Static Ads?
Static ads are fixed image ads, often in formats like JPG, PNG, or GIF. They display one image and a single message.
Best for:
- Simple, clear messaging
- Quick promotions
- Small file sizes and fast load times
Pros:
- Easy to design and deploy
- Lower production cost
- Lightweight, fast loading
Cons:
- Limited engagement
- Not interactive
- Can get lost in the noise
What Are HTML5 Animated Ads?
HTML5 ads use animation and transitions to bring static visuals to life. These ads can include multiple images, movements, interactions, or even videos—making them more dynamic and immersive.
Best for:
- Brand storytelling
- Showcasing product features
- Increasing time spent on ad
Pros:
- Higher engagement and attention
- More space for messaging (via multiple frames)
- Can include animation, interactivity, and even video
Cons:
- Slightly larger file sizes
- Longer production time
- May require third-party ad hosting or tag management
Performance: Engagement & Clicks
Studies show that animated ads tend to outperform static ads when it comes to click-through rate (CTR) and user engagement. Movement naturally draws the eye, giving your message more visibility.
However, context matters:
- If your ad is part of a fast-scrolling mobile feed, a quick-hitting static ad might work better.
- For desktop placements with longer view times, animation adds value and increases engagement.
Design Considerations
Feature | Static Ad | HTML5 Animated Ad |
---|---|---|
File Type | JPG, PNG, GIF | HTML5, JS, CSS |
File Size (Avg) | 50–150 KB | 150–400 KB |
Motion Support | ❌ | ✅ |
Interactivity | ❌ | ✅ |
Time to Produce | ⏱ Fast | ⏳ Moderate |
Best Use Case | Simple promos | Complex messaging |
Which Should You Choose?
- Go with static if you need fast, budget-friendly ads with simple messaging.
- Choose HTML5 if you want to stand out, communicate more, and drive stronger engagement.
Pro Tip: Run A/B tests with both formats. Let the data show which performs best for your audience and platform.
